// CheckInventoryAvailability validates that the warehouse has sufficient stock for each item.
|
||||
// Returns an error describing the first shortage encountered.
|
||||
func (s *StockService) CheckInventoryAvailability(shopID, warehouseID uint64, items []model.StockOutItem) error {
|
||||
if len(items) == 0 {
|
||||
return nil
|
||||
}
|
||||
|
||||
productIDs := make([]uint64, 0, len(items))
|
||||
for _, item := range items {
|
||||
productIDs = append(productIDs, item.ProductID)
|
||||
}
|
||||
|
||||
type inventorySum struct {
|
||||
ProductID uint64
|
||||
Total float64
|
||||
}
|
||||
var sums []inventorySum
|
||||
s.db.Model(&model.Inventory{}).
|
||||
Select("product_id, COALESCE(SUM(quantity), 0) AS total").
|
||||
Where("shop_id = ? AND warehouse_id = ? AND product_id IN ? AND deleted_at IS NULL",
|
||||
shopID, warehouseID, productIDs).
|
||||
Group("product_id").Scan(&sums)
|
||||
|
||||
sumMap := make(map[uint64]float64, len(sums))
|
||||
for _, s := range sums {
|
||||
sumMap[s.ProductID] = s.Total
|
||||
}
|
||||
|
||||
for _, item := range items {
|
||||
have := sumMap[item.ProductID]
|
||||
if have < item.Quantity {
|
||||
var p model.Product
|
||||
s.db.Where("id = ?", item.ProductID).First(&p)
|
||||
name := p.Name
|
||||
if name == "" {
|
||||
name = fmt.Sprintf("商品ID %d", item.ProductID)
|
||||
}
|
||||
return fmt.Errorf("库存不足:%s 当前库存 %.0f,需要 %.0f", name, have, item.Quantity)
|
||||
}
|
||||
}
|
||||
return nil
|
||||
}
